The description above refers, in a simplified way, to the theory of the primitive hut developed by the abbot Marc-Antoine Laugier in the mid-1700s. The small rustic hut described by Laugier is a model upon which he imagined the magnificence of architecture.

Dezeen Showroom: created by designer Marco Lavit for Italian outdoor furniture company Ethimo , the Hut lounge bed offers a peaceful, nature-attuned place to escape the sun. The Hut lounge bed is distinguished by its conical, semi-enclosed structure, which conjures feelings of both relaxation and protection.
